Summer Sunshine

A friend of mine ask me to make her a card for her nephew whose retiring from the ministry.  I thought a blue and yellow.....summery approach would be fun and came up with the above card.
Supplies used:
  • Stamps
    • Flora Grande 2 Heartfelt Creations
    • Martha Stewart Leaf
    • Love Border (Inkakindadoo - I think)
  • Punches
    • Martha Stewart corner punch
    • Threading Water border punch (Fiskars)
  • Inks
    • Blue/Green Chalks (edges of flower and leaves)
    • Versa Mark
    • Green/Blue ink
  • Blue Embossing Powder (flowers)
  • Yellow Glitter (flower center)
  • Kassie's Brocade embossing folder (Provo Craft)
  • Strip of Vintage Lace (behind flower)
I stamped a single floral image on the envelope so it would match the card....I chalked the edges and colored the center yellow with a Crayola marker.
I liked this style so much that I decided to make a wedding card for a friend in the same design -- just used different colors...
Once again I stamped the envelope to match
I have a feeling I'll be using this again as I really like the way these turned out.
